Output 70cbda340c7a555f8be26a5096924cc4193cd6781a868ff64296e9b80802a3a6:1

value
586513
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 cc611c667de8ce5f3a6a6a0040559f61876354b7 OP_EQUALVERIFY OP_CHECKSIG
address
1KdfBX9NaXowhdShheetya9EMykiQM27aG
transaction
70cbda340c7a555f8be26a5096924cc4193cd6781a868ff64296e9b80802a3a6
spent
true